The <br />Department requests that the Traffic Commission review the recommendations and provide us with your <br />comments. <br /> <br />Also please find attached comments from councilmember Larry Lieberman for the Traffic <br />Commissioner’s consideration. <br /> <br /> <br />2.Street Petition to make the 6500 block of Corbitt Ave, one-way going east. <br />During the February 11, 2004 Traffic Commission Meeting, the Commissioners reviewed the petition <br />from the 6500 block of Corbitt Neighborhood Association to make Corbitt Ave. (from Kingsland to <br />Sutter) a one-way street going east. <br /> <br />The commissioners recommended contacting the residents on the adjacent blocks and asking them to <br />provide their comments. <br /> <br />The Engineering Division contacted the residents, the Police and Fire Departments, and installed a traffic <br />counter for Corbitt Ave (from Kingsland to Sutter). Please find attached comments from Major Charles <br />Adams from the Police Department. <br /> <br />As of February 27, 2004, the Engineering Division has received a couple of phone calls and an email in <br />opposition to the request. Those responding are concerned about not only the increase of traffic for Etzel <br />Ave., but also more cars speeding on Etzel and Avalon. <br /> <br />The Engineering Division will give a recommendation on this request once the results of the traffic <br />counts and police accidents reports are evaluated. <br /> <br /> <br />3.Approval of the minutes from the February 11, 2004 meeting <br /> <br />Thank you. <br /> <br />Cc: Shelley Welsch, Council Liaison <br /> Evelyn Shields-Benford, Director of Public Works <br /> Lee Payne, Police Chief <br /> Lehman Walker, Director for Planning Department <br />1 <br />V:\WP51\Mariela-Projects\Traffic Commission\agenda\2004\Agenda 3-10-04.doc <br />
